Cerritos, Calif. Resident Albert Chen Promoted to Senior Vice President in Thornton Tomasetti’s Los Angeles Office

Albert Chen, P.E., S.E., a resident of Cerritos, Calif., has been promoted to senior vice president in the Los Angeles office of Thornton Tomasetti, the international engineering firm. 

Mr. Chen has more than 30 years of experience in the structural design of mixed-use, commercial, retail, parking, healthcare, education and hospitality projects. His background includes overseeing tenant improvement projects, forensic investigations, new building design, and seismic upgrades for existing structures. His responsibilities include project management with technical involvement from concept design through construction, quality control and quality assurance and business development.

He is a licensed Civil Engineer and Structural Engineer in California and a licensed Professional Engineer in Washington. He is a member of the Earthquake Engineering Research Institute, the Structural Engineers Association of Southern California (SEAOSC). He is active on the SEAOSC Seismology Committee, which is heavily involved in the development of U.S. seismic codes.

Mr. Chen holds a bachelor’s degree in civil engineering from Chung Yuan University in Taiwan and a master's degree in structural engineering from the University of Texas, Arlington.

About Thornton Tomasetti

Thornton Tomasetti is a leader in engineering design, investigation and analysis serving clients worldwide on projects of all sizes and complexity. With practices in building structure, building skin, building performance, construction support services, building sustainability and property loss consulting, Thornton Tomasetti addresses the full life cycle of a structure. We have supported clients working in more than 50 countries, with projects that include the tallest buildings and longest spans to the restoration of prized historic properties. Founded in 1956, today Thornton Tomasetti is a 600-person organization of engineers and architects collaborating from offices across the United States and in Asia-Pacific, Europe and the Middle East.
